Perkinsiella saccharicida (Sugarcane Planthopper) - Uttarakhand, India
Perkinsiella saccharicida (Sugarcane Planthopper). Photographed at Milieu Villa Birding Lodge, Uttarakhand, India on 14 April 2023.
18
views
0
faves
0
comments
Uploaded on November 23, 2023
Taken on April 14, 2023
Perkinsiella saccharicida (Sugarcane Planthopper) - Uttarakhand, India
Perkinsiella saccharicida (Sugarcane Planthopper). Photographed at Milieu Villa Birding Lodge, Uttarakhand, India on 14 April 2023.
18
views
0
faves
0
comments
Uploaded on November 23, 2023
Taken on April 14, 2023